Burton Space Sack Snowboard Bag 2013

Burton Space Sack Snowboard Bag: You’ll get baseline protection for your board and your buddy’s, with the Burton Space Sack Snowboard Bag. The simplified, durable design with room for multiple decks has shoulder straps for an additional carrying option.
Size and Volume
Varying sizes available: 129cm (132cm x 36cm x 18cm)
146cm (150cm x 36cm x 18cm)
156cm (163cm x 36cm x 18cm)
166cm (172cm x 36cm x 18cm)
181cm (183cm x 36cm x 18cm)
2.2 lbs. (1 kg)
Material
600D Polyester
Special Features
Multiple board capacity
Removable shoulder strap
Durable board protection

Specs

  • Capacity: Multiple Boards
  • Includes Wheels: No
  • Warranty: 1 Year
  • Material: Polyester

Most Liked Positive Review

 

Life Saver Flying to Denver

I bought the board bag because I found a cheap flight out to Denver and couldn't pass up the opportunity to go out there. I bought the bag with the intention of fitting my board...Read complete review

I bought the board bag because I found a cheap flight out to Denver and couldn't pass up the opportunity to go out there. I bought the bag with the intention of fitting my board and my friend's board in there.

After some creative packaging, I was able to fit my 160 board in there (with the bindings removed), her 150 board (with her bindings still attached, my bindings (loose), plus my size 13 boots and her size 9 boots and my helmet. We also got two pair of snow pants and some assorted base layer and clothes in there. We wore our jackets, but they would not have fit with all that extra gear.

The boards arrived in Denver unscathed, and after a few minutes of reattaching my bindings, we were good to go.

On the way back we even had room for 3 fifth of some delicious Colorado whiskey (stored in the boots). The bottles were not harmed on the trip back.

I also put a towel between the boards so they wouldn't scratch each other.
